Implant Dentistry Questions
When patients lose permanent teeth it's not uncommon for them to have many questions about how to replace them. One option is dental implants. Because this is a surgical procedure, it requires some serious consideration.
What are the advantages of dental implants?
Dental implants are a permanent solution. When cared for properly your dental implants can last as long as a natural tooth. Dental implants are artificial teeth, but look very natural and feel secure. They can be a single tooth or a bridge. Implants will keep neighboring teeth from moving, prevent bone loss, will make your smile and speech more natural and are as secure as natural teeth for biting and chewing.
What are the disadvantages of dental implants?
Being a surgical procedure, not all patients are healthy enough for implant dentistry isn't for everyone. At our Advanced Cosmetic Dentistry & TMJ clinic you will undergo a thorough medical and dental evaluation to ensure that you are healthy enough to undergo surgery.
You must be in a position to wait for the healing and return for the attachment and follow up visit. The procedure is done over several months, and may take as long as a year. Dr. Deldar's method of implant dentistry involves two stages. First the anchor is implanted into the jaw bone. Healing and bonding to the bone takes several months. When secure, the dental implant attached to the implant.
What are the risks of dental implants?
Every dental procedure and/or surgery carries with it some degree of risk. Some of the most common risks include infection of the gums or jaw bone. Roots of neighboring teeth can be damaged as can nerves that connect the lip or sinuses.
